The revelation that a 29-year-old homeless man begging while playing the guitar in the streets of New Jersey is the son of multi-millionaire singer Tom Jones has caused a sensation.
Despite his father's fortune of 177 million euros, Jonathan relies daily on the obols of passers-by in order to earn some money to buy a plate of food.
On a piece of cardboard, which he has placed in his guitar case, he has written the phrase "I need money, please help me".
Jonathan Berkeley is the fruit of the short-lived bond that his mother, Kathryn, had with the famous Welsh singer. It was October 1987 when the 24-year-old model was seduced by the charm of “Mr. Sex Bomb ”.
Tom Jones had denied that he was Jonathan's biological father, but the DNA test confirmed it. Following a court order, he paid 1.900 euros each month as alimony until the child became an adult. Other than that, however, he was never interested in his son.
"I never received a card for my birthday or Christmas. I grew up watching photos of my father. But the phone calls and e-mails I sent him went unanswered. He never wanted to have a relationship with me ", says Jonathan, in the revealing report of the British newspaper Daily Mail.
In the video published by the Daily Mail, Jonathan Berkeri sings one of his father's great hits, the famous "Delilah"…
"I never met paternal affection," says the 29-year-old homeless man.
When asked if he wanted anything to ask from his famous father, he replied: "I do not want anything from my father, I only asked for his love."
